GOD'S INSEPARABLE LOVE FOR US: in Christ Jesus Our Lord (Message #15 * Romans 8:31-39) 02-24-2013
If God is For Us . . . who can be Against Us? ● God gave up His Son for us all: so God will give us all things (vs31-32) ● God justifies and Christ interceeds for us: so no one can condemn us (vs33-34) --> Trust in God’s protective provisions: and enjoy His grace in our daily lives Who shall Separate Us from the Love of God in Christ? ● We Suffer in this life for Christ: knowing that nothing can separate us from His love (vs35-36) -->Embrace God’s call to Suffering: and be comforted and empowered by the love of Jesus ● We are more than Conquerors through Him who loved us: for nothing can separate us from the love of God in Christ Jesus our Lord (vs37-39) --> Live Triumphantly in Christ: with the assurance of God’s inseparable love for us now and for all eternity

What The Hell Is HELL?
What is Hell? How does hell relate to the justice and love of God? The biblical teaching of a final judgment is crucial for Christian living because it enables us to forgive others freely and provides a moral restraint against sin. It magnifies the justice of God in punishing evil and putting the world to right. Only against the grim and dark backdrop of divine anger can we see the glorious splendor of the Father’s love for us who would send His only Son to experience hell on our behalf.
